Project Number Date
test_Tails_ISO_20904-tor-browser-14.5-force-all-tests 5 24 Apr 2025, 14:24

Feature Report

Steps Scenarios Features
Feature Passed Failed Skipped Pending Undefined Total Passed Failed Total Duration Status
Hardware failures 95 0 0 0 0 95 12 0 12 17:25.515 Passed
Tags: @product
Feature Hardware failures
In order to update my failing hardware before I lose data As a Tails user I want to be warned about hardware failures
40.227
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.174
And SquashFS is damaged in a way that some read operations fail 0.000
When I start the computer 1.025
Then the computer boots Tails 36.700
And I see a disk failure message on the splash screen 2.326
After features/support/hooks.rb:330 0.572
After features/support/hooks.rb:100 0.009
39.984
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.168
And boot device is damaged in a way that some read operations fail 0.000
When I start the computer 1.022
Then the computer boots Tails 36.664
And I see a disk failure message on the splash screen 2.130
After features/support/hooks.rb:330 0.559
After features/support/hooks.rb:100 0.009
40.424
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.194
And boot device with a target error is damaged in a way that some read operations fail 0.000
When I start the computer 1.042
Then the computer boots Tails 35.861
And I see a disk failure message on the splash screen 3.325
After features/support/hooks.rb:330 0.583
After features/support/hooks.rb:100 0.054
Tags: @product @doc
41.666
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.176
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.438
When Tails detects disk read failures on the SquashFS 0.346
Then I see a disk failure message 3.450
Then I can open the hardware failure documentation from the disk failure message 28.254
After features/support/hooks.rb:330 4.111
After features/support/hooks.rb:100 0.000
Tags: @product @doc
43.591
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.201
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.561
When Tails detects disk read failures on the boot device 1.703
Then I see a disk failure message 1.542
Then I can open the hardware failure documentation from the disk failure message 30.582
After features/support/hooks.rb:330 3.577
After features/support/hooks.rb:100 0.000
Tags: @product @doc
40.971
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.208
And I have started Tails without network from a USB drive with a persistent partition enabled and logged in 9.660
When Tails detects disk read failures on the boot device with a target error 1.517
Then I see a disk failure message 1.298
Then I can open the hardware failure documentation from the disk failure message 28.286
After features/support/hooks.rb:330 3.445
After features/support/hooks.rb:100 0.000
Tags: @product
1:47.057
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 12.045
And I corrupt the boot device's GPT backup header 0.346
And I power off the computer 0.351
When I start the computer 1.061
Then the computer boots Tails 1:7.323
When I log in to a new session 18.450
And all notifications have disappeared 7.257
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.205
And Tails detected partitioning error partitioning-corruption 0.015
After features/support/hooks.rb:330 0.679
After features/support/hooks.rb:100 0.018
Tags: @product
1:42.284
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given I have started Tails without network from a USB drive with a persistent partition and stopped at Tails Greeter's login screen 9.774
And I corrupt the boot device's GPT backup partition table 0.356
And I power off the computer 0.372
When I start the computer 1.069
Then the computer boots Tails 1:6.386
When I log in to a new session 18.089
And all notifications have disappeared 5.972
Then I am recommended to migrate to a new USB stick due to partitioning errors 0.249
And Tails detected partitioning error partitioning-corruption 0.012
After features/support/hooks.rb:330 0.690
After features/support/hooks.rb:100 0.009
Tags: @product
2:57.817
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.006
Given a computer 0.172
And I set Tails to boot with options "test_gpt_corruption=gpt_backup,gpt_backup_table"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.045
And I plug USB drive "temp" 1.050
And I write the Tails USB image to disk "temp" 36.773
When I start Tails from USB drive "temp" with network unplugged 1:50.337
Then Tails is running from USB drive "temp" 0.441
And the Greeter forbids creating a persistent partition 0.088
When I log in to a new session 17.156
And all notifications have disappeared 7.889
Then I am recommended to reinstall Tails due to partitioning errors 0.209
# We are gonna verify the dialog again so we need to clean up the
# first instance.
And I close the "zenity" window 1.263
And I am told that Persistent Storage cannot be created 2.376
And Tails detected partitioning error partitioning-corruption 0.012
After features/support/hooks.rb:330 1.172
After features/support/hooks.rb:100 0.090
Tags: @product
2:51.595
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.005
Given a computer 0.240
And I set Tails to boot with options "test_partitioning_errors=guid"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.068
And I plug USB drive "temp" 1.055
And I write the Tails USB image to disk "temp" 33.247
When I start Tails from USB drive "temp" with network unplugged 2:16.072
Then Tails is running from USB drive "temp" 0.346
And the Greeter recommends reinstalling Tails due to partitioning errors 0.088
And the Greeter forbids starting Tails 0.062
And the Greeter forbids all settings but language 0.399
And Tails detected partitioning error guid-not-randomized 0.012
After features/support/hooks.rb:330 0.954
After features/support/hooks.rb:100 0.131
Tags: @product
2:4.422
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.010
Given a computer 0.181
And I set Tails to boot with options "test_partitioning_errors=part_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.047
And I plug USB drive "temp" 1.060
And I write the Tails USB image to disk "temp" 27.789
When I start Tails from USB drive "temp" with network unplugged 1:34.510
Then Tails is running from USB drive "temp" 0.333
And the Greeter recommends reinstalling Tails due to partitioning errors 0.091
And the Greeter forbids starting Tails 0.062
And the Greeter forbids all settings but language 0.331
And Tails detected partitioning error system-partition-not-resized 0.012
After features/support/hooks.rb:330 0.722
After features/support/hooks.rb:100 0.141
Tags: @product
1:55.472
Before features/support/hooks.rb:266 0.000
Before features/support/hooks.rb:273 0.007
Given a computer 0.176
And I set Tails to boot with options "test_partitioning_errors=fs_resize" 0.000
And I temporarily create a 7200 MiB disk named "temp" 0.036
And I plug USB drive "temp" 1.048
And I write the Tails USB image to disk "temp" 26.464
When I start Tails from USB drive "temp" with network unplugged 1:26.804
Then Tails is running from USB drive "temp" 0.446
And the Greeter recommends reinstalling Tails due to partitioning errors 0.088
And the Greeter forbids starting Tails 0.090
And the Greeter forbids all settings but language 0.303
And Tails detected partitioning error fs-not-resized 0.012
After features/support/hooks.rb:330 0.655
After features/support/hooks.rb:100 0.139